{{tag>untagged needs_pic incomplete}} This recipe is tagged as incomplete, use at your own risk! ====Hotdog or burger buns==== Date added: 2025/07/04 ===Ingredients=== ==Tangzhong== *150g water *68g AP flour *190g milk ==Dough Ingredients== *25g sugar *14g yeast *2 TBSP warm water *264g warm milk *27g oil *2 tsps diamond kosher *650-830 AP flour *1 egg plus a little water for eggwash *optional: seeds * ===Method=== -Add all ingredients for tangzhong to a saucepan set over medium-high heat. Cook the mixture, whisking constantly, until it thickens and forms a thick slurry; this will take about 1 1/2 to 2 1/2 minutes. Remove from heat and let it cool to lukewarm. -In bowl of stand mixer, dissolve yeast and sugar withh milk and water. After yeast blooms, add tangzhong and mix on low to combine. -Add remaining ingredients (except egg wash) and knead on medium low for 6 minutes. -Add dough to oiled bowl. cover. let rise in warm place for about 1 hour. -Turn the dough out onto a lightly oiled work surface. Divide into 18 equal pieces. Shape each piece into a ball. For hamburger buns, flatten the balls into 3 1/2" disks. For hot-dog buns, roll the balls into cylinders, 4 1/2" in length. Flatten the cylinders slightly; dough rises more in the center so this will give a gently rounded top versus a high top. adjust if needed for size of dogs/burgers. -For soft-sided buns, place them on a well-seasoned baking sheet a half inch apart so they'll grow together when they rise. For crisper buns, place them 3" apart. - Cover and let rise about 45 minutes. - Fifteen minutes before you want to bake your buns, preheat your oven to 400°F. Just before baking, lightly brush the tops of the buns with the egg wash and sprinkle with seeds if desired. - Bake for 20 minutes or until the internal temperature of the bread reaches 190°F when measured with a digital thermometer. - When the buns are done, remove them from the baking sheet to cool on a wire rack. This will prevent the crust from becoming soggy. - Split the buns in half and toast or griddle before serving, as desired. Store leftover buns at room temperature in an airtight container for several days, or freeze. - To reheat from froze, place buns on plate, microwave at full power for 1 min. Then split and toast to finish. ===Notes=== Flour used varies by climate conditions, but so far I am at upper range every time.
